public class AbstractShiroConfiguration extends Object
| Modifier and Type | Field and Description |
|---|---|
protected org.apache.shiro.cache.CacheManager |
cacheManager |
protected org.apache.shiro.event.EventBus |
eventBus |
protected org.apache.shiro.authz.permission.PermissionResolver |
permissionResolver |
protected org.apache.shiro.authz.permission.RolePermissionResolver |
rolePermissionResolver |
protected boolean |
sessionManagerDeleteInvalidSessions |
| Constructor and Description |
|---|
AbstractShiroConfiguration() |
| Modifier and Type | Method and Description |
|---|---|
protected org.apache.shiro.authc.pam.AuthenticationStrategy |
authenticationStrategy() |
protected org.apache.shiro.authc.Authenticator |
authenticator() |
protected org.apache.shiro.authz.Authorizer |
authorizer() |
protected org.apache.shiro.mgt.SessionsSecurityManager |
createSecurityManager() |
protected org.apache.shiro.realm.Realm |
iniRealmFromLocation(String iniLocation) |
protected org.apache.shiro.mgt.RememberMeManager |
rememberMeManager() |
protected org.apache.shiro.mgt.SessionsSecurityManager |
securityManager(List<org.apache.shiro.realm.Realm> realms) |
protected org.apache.shiro.session.mgt.eis.SessionDAO |
sessionDAO() |
protected org.apache.shiro.session.mgt.SessionFactory |
sessionFactory() |
protected org.apache.shiro.session.mgt.SessionManager |
sessionManager() |
protected org.apache.shiro.mgt.SessionStorageEvaluator |
sessionStorageEvaluator() |
protected org.apache.shiro.mgt.SubjectDAO |
subjectDAO() |
protected org.apache.shiro.mgt.SubjectFactory |
subjectFactory() |
@Autowired(required=false) protected org.apache.shiro.cache.CacheManager cacheManager
@Autowired(required=false) protected org.apache.shiro.authz.permission.RolePermissionResolver rolePermissionResolver
@Autowired(required=false) protected org.apache.shiro.authz.permission.PermissionResolver permissionResolver
@Autowired protected org.apache.shiro.event.EventBus eventBus
@Value(value="#{ @environment[\'shiro.sessionManager.deleteInvalidSessions\'] ?: true }")
protected boolean sessionManagerDeleteInvalidSessions
protected org.apache.shiro.mgt.SessionsSecurityManager securityManager(List<org.apache.shiro.realm.Realm> realms)
protected org.apache.shiro.session.mgt.SessionManager sessionManager()
protected org.apache.shiro.mgt.SessionsSecurityManager createSecurityManager()
protected org.apache.shiro.mgt.RememberMeManager rememberMeManager()
protected org.apache.shiro.mgt.SubjectDAO subjectDAO()
protected org.apache.shiro.mgt.SessionStorageEvaluator sessionStorageEvaluator()
protected org.apache.shiro.mgt.SubjectFactory subjectFactory()
protected org.apache.shiro.session.mgt.SessionFactory sessionFactory()
protected org.apache.shiro.session.mgt.eis.SessionDAO sessionDAO()
protected org.apache.shiro.authz.Authorizer authorizer()
protected org.apache.shiro.authc.pam.AuthenticationStrategy authenticationStrategy()
protected org.apache.shiro.authc.Authenticator authenticator()
protected org.apache.shiro.realm.Realm iniRealmFromLocation(String iniLocation)
Copyright © 2004–2017 The Apache Software Foundation. All rights reserved.